How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bridgefield?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ent | 
|---|---|---|---|
| Bridgefield Studio Apartments | $930 | $705 | $1,194 | 
| Bridgefield 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,102 | $699 | $1,720 | 
| Bridgefield 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,325 | $770 | $2,899 | 
| Bridgefield 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,511 | $1,124 | $2,329 |
